Job Summary
The position will assist in increasing the profitability of existing products and aids in developing new products for the company. The position will be responsible for building products from existing ideas or helping develop new ones based on their experience, representing the interests and needs of customers, prospects, and partners.
Essential Duties/Responsibilities
- Develops product strategies and plans to increase overall usage and user satisfaction
- Assists in the translation of business goals and objectives into a concrete strategy and tactical plan
- Assesses and specifies market requirements for current and future products through conducting market research and on-going discussions with internal clients and client-facing teams
- Manages the entire product line life cycle, from strategic planning to tactical execution
- Develops, implements, and manages product features in collaboration with development partners
- Prepares detailed and comprehensive product requirements and statements of work
- Provides feedback on product costs and budget impact
- Performs other duties as assigned
- Complies with all policies and standards
